SOURCES: synergy-client.conf (NEW), synergy-server.conf (NEW), syn...

arekm arekm at pld-linux.org
Tue Apr 1 10:58:04 CEST 2008


Author: arekm                        Date: Tue Apr  1 08:58:04 2008 GMT
Module: SOURCES                       Tag: HEAD
---- Log message:
- simple and not very smart scripts

---- Files affected:
SOURCES:
   synergy-client.conf (NONE -> 1.1)  (NEW), synergy-server.conf (NONE -> 1.1)  (NEW), synergy-server-layout.conf (NONE -> 1.1)  (NEW), synergy-client.init (NONE -> 1.1)  (NEW), synergy-server.init (NONE -> 1.1)  (NEW)

---- Diffs:

================================================================
Index: SOURCES/synergy-client.conf
diff -u /dev/null SOURCES/synergy-client.conf:1.1
--- /dev/null	Tue Apr  1 10:58:04 2008
+++ SOURCES/synergy-client.conf	Tue Apr  1 10:57:59 2008
@@ -0,0 +1,5 @@
+# short name for this client (defaults to hostname -s setting); used in layout.conf on the server
+# SYNERGYC_NAME="sclient"
+#
+# connect to server:port
+# SYNERGY_SERVER="192.168.1.1"

================================================================
Index: SOURCES/synergy-server.conf
diff -u /dev/null SOURCES/synergy-server.conf:1.1
--- /dev/null	Tue Apr  1 10:58:04 2008
+++ SOURCES/synergy-server.conf	Tue Apr  1 10:57:59 2008
@@ -0,0 +1,5 @@
+# short name for this server (defaults to hostname -s setting); used in layout.conf
+# SYNERGYS_NAME="sserver"
+
+# Listen address:port (defaults to all interfaces; port 24800)
+# SYNERGYS_ADDRESS=

================================================================
Index: SOURCES/synergy-server-layout.conf
diff -u /dev/null SOURCES/synergy-server-layout.conf:1.1
--- /dev/null	Tue Apr  1 10:58:04 2008
+++ SOURCES/synergy-server-layout.conf	Tue Apr  1 10:57:59 2008
@@ -0,0 +1,11 @@
+section: screens
+       sserver:
+       sclient:
+end
+section: links
+       sserver:
+           right = sclient
+       sclient:
+           left = sserver
+end
+

================================================================
Index: SOURCES/synergy-client.init
diff -u /dev/null SOURCES/synergy-client.init:1.1
--- /dev/null	Tue Apr  1 10:58:04 2008
+++ SOURCES/synergy-client.init	Tue Apr  1 10:57:59 2008
@@ -0,0 +1,28 @@
+#!/bin/sh
+
+# Source function library
+. /etc/rc.d/init.d/functions
+
+# Get network config
+. /etc/sysconfig/network
+
+# Get service config
+[ -f /etc/synergy/client.conf ] && . /etc/synergy/client.conf
+
+# Check that networking is up.
+if ! is_yes "${NETWORKING}"; then
+	echo "$0: Networking disabled" >&2
+        exit 0
+fi
+
+if [ -z "$SYNERGY_SERVER" ]; then
+	echo "$0: SYNERGY_SERVER not set. Please update /etc/synergy/client.conf"
+fi
+
+SYNERGYC_NAME=${SYNERGYC_NAME:-hostname -s}
+
+killall -TERM synergyc 2> /dev/null
+usleep 300
+killall -9 synergyc 2> /dev/null
+
+/usr/bin/synergyc --daemon --restart -n ${SYNERGYC_NAME} ${SYNERGY_SERVER}

================================================================
Index: SOURCES/synergy-server.init
diff -u /dev/null SOURCES/synergy-server.init:1.1
--- /dev/null	Tue Apr  1 10:58:04 2008
+++ SOURCES/synergy-server.init	Tue Apr  1 10:57:59 2008
@@ -0,0 +1,26 @@
+#!/bin/sh
+
+# Source function library
+. /etc/rc.d/init.d/functions
+
+# Get network config
+. /etc/sysconfig/network
+
+# Get service config
+[ -f /etc/synergy/server.conf ] && . /etc/synergy/server.conf
+
+# Check that networking is up.
+if ! is_yes "${NETWORKING}"; then
+	echo "$0: Networking disabled" >&2
+        exit 0
+fi
+
+SYNERGYS_NAME=${SYNERGYS_NAME:-hostname -s}
+
+[ -n "$SYNERGYS_ADDRESS" ] && SYNERGYS_OPTS="$SYNERGYS_OPTS --address $SYNERGYS_ADDRESS"
+
+killall -TERM synergys 2> /dev/null
+usleep 300
+killall -9 synergys 2> /dev/null
+
+/usr/bin/synergys --daemon --restart -n ${SYNERGYS_NAME} --config /etc/synergy/layout.conf ${SYNERGYS_OPTS}
================================================================


More information about the pld-cvs-commit mailing list